Shared ownership provides an affordable way for you to become a homeowner, by buying a share in a new home and paying a subsidised rent on the remaining share. You can then purchase further shares in your home, up to 100%, which we call "staircasing". As further shares are purchased the rent reduces accordingly. Holmes Chapel offers a variety of independently family run businesses and quaint little boutiques within the town centre, along with everyday essential amenities including the famous Mandeville bakery. There is an excellent choice of pubs and restaurants too! There are plenty of lovely places to visit in the local area including Brereton Heath Nature reserve and the famous Jodrell Bank Observatory. The Blue Dot festival is held annually and features a weekend of music, science, arts and cosmic culture, an event certainly not to be missed.
Holmes Chapel train station sits on the Crewe to Manchester Line, providing two half hourly services departing to Manchester Piccadilly. The line runs over the historic Twemlow aqueduct which carries the railway over the River Dane. Junction 18 of the M6 motorway is only a mile and a half away from Bluebell Green, providing convenient access to a wealth of major road networks, including links to Manchester and Liverpool city centres which are less than an hour's drive.
Families moving to Bluebell Green will find they don't have to travel far to find good local schools. Hermitage Primary School and Holmes Chapel Primary School are within a commutable distance and both boast the top level of Ofsted rating achievable making these very desirable schools with places being taken up quickly. Holmes Chapel Comprehensive School and Sixth Form also shares the trend of Outstanding Ofsted reports within the village and is a wonderful option for the next step in education for the locals.
